Hamas terrorist wounded in assassination attempt in Lebanon

A bomb blast wounded a Hamas terrorist in the Lebanese city of Sidon on Sunday, destroying his car, security sources and the Hezbollah terror group’s al-Manar television station reported.

The targeted terrorist was Mohamed Hamdan, also known as Abu Hamza, the sources and al-Manar said. He was “slightly wounded”.

A Lebanese security official said the bomb was placed under the car seat. The official Lebanon News Agency said the explosion went off as Hamdan was getting into the car.

The blast destroyed Hamdan’s silver BMW and sent a column of smoke into the sky over Sidon, 40 km (25 miles) south of Beirut, television footage from the scene broadcast by Lebanese television stations showed.

Contrary to first reports, witnesses said the terrorist targeted in the attack appeared to have been wounded in the leg. Sidon Mayor Mohammed Saudi said Hamdan was undergoing surgery in a local hospital.

Hamas has been increasing it’s ties to Hezbollah in Lebanon recently as part of efforts to resume terrorism cooperation with Iran.
